Foundation Underpinning in Sarasota, FL
Foundation underpinning services involve strengthening and stabilizing the existing foundation of a property to prevent or address issues caused by shifting, settling, or damage. This process is commonly requested for homes experiencing uneven floors, cracks in walls, or other signs of foundation movement. Projects can include raising, leveling, or reinforcing foundations to ensure stability and safety, particularly in areas prone to soil movement or moisture-related settling. Property owners often seek underpinning when preparing for renovations, after noticing structural concerns, or to protect their investment from further damage.
Before requesting underpinning services, property owners typically want to understand the extent of the foundation issues, the methods used for stabilization, and how the work might impact their property. It’s important to consider the specific conditions of the site, such as soil type and drainage, as these factors influence the appropriate approach. Clarifying expectations about the process, timeline, and potential disruptions can help homeowners make informed decisions about addressing foundation concerns effectively.

Common Foundation Underpinning Jobs
Foundation Underpinning - stabilizes and reinforces existing foundations to prevent settling or shifting.
Pier and Beam Support - lifts and supports homes built on piers to correct uneven or sagging floors.
Concrete Slab Repair - addresses cracks and sinking in concrete slabs to maintain structural integrity.
Settlement Repair - remedies uneven or sinking foundations caused by soil movement or moisture changes.
Crawl Space Stabilization - improves support and reduces moisture issues in crawl space foundations.
Foundation Replacement - replaces severely damaged foundations to ensure long-term stability.
Foundation Underpinning Questions
What are foundation underpinning services? Foundation underpinning involves strengthening and stabilizing a building's foundation to prevent settling or shifting issues.
When is underpinning necessary? Underpinning is typically needed when there are signs of foundation movement, such as cracks in walls or uneven floors.
What methods are used for underpinning? Common methods include piering and slab jacking, which provide additional support beneath the existing foundation.
How can property owners tell if underpinning is needed? Signs like cracked walls, doors that stick, or uneven flooring may indicate foundation issues requiring underpinning.
